Pros
  • Real-time alerts and detailed performance metrics
  • Supports common VPN devices (Cisco, Fortinet, etc.) out-of-the-box
  • Highly customizable dashboards and reports
  • Affordable device-based licensing with a free trial available
Cons
  • Steeper learning curve for full feature set (UI can be overwhelming at first)
  • Some advanced features require extra modules or licenses
  • Support is 24/5, not 24/7 by default
  • UI performance may lag in very large deployments
Summary

ManageEngine OpManager’s VPN Monitoring is a feature within the OpManager platform that focuses on keeping your VPN connections healthy and secure. In practice, it means network administrators can watch over all their site-to-site VPN tunnels and remote access gateways from a single pane of glass. The system actively polls devices (like routers and firewalls) to check if VPN tunnels are up, measures how much data is flowing, and even notes the encryption standards in use. If a VPN link drops or performance degrades, OpManager will immediately fire off an alert so IT staff can respond before users feel the impact. What sets OpManager apart is that it doesn’t stop at VPNs – it ties that information into a full network monitoring suite. This way, you can see if a VPN issue is related to a wider network problem. The platform is known for its rich feature set (alerts, reports, automation, etc.) and its cost-effective licensing. While new users might need some training to harness all its power, most agree that OpManager greatly simplifies the ongoing task of network and VPN management.
